Kaczory was formerly part of the German Empire. In the German Empire, the place was called Erpel (Kr. Kolmar, Wartheland).
The place is now called Kaczory and belongs to Poland.
| Historical place name | Country | Administration | Time |
|---|---|---|---|
| Erpel (Bz. Bromberg) | German Empire | Kolmar i. Posen | before the Versailles Treaty |
| Kaczory | Poland | Chodzież | after the Versailles Treaty |
| Erpel | German Empire | Kolmar (Wartheland) | 1939 |
| Erpel (Kr. Kolmar, Wartheland) | German Empire | Kolmar (Wartheland) | 1939 |
| Kaczory | Poland | Chodzież | 1945 |
| Kaczory | Poland | Piła | 1992 |
